Think you could be due for a new battery in your 2024 Mercedes-Benz EQE 350+? Batteries generally need to be replaced every three to five years. Yours may need to be replaced sooner depending on your driving habits and climate. Taking short trips or exposing your car to extreme temperatures (like in the dead of winter or heat of summer) could reduce the life expectancy of your Mercedes-Benz EQE 350+ battery.
